LFJ Encourages Broadscale Support for Persons Living with Lupus
The public is being encouraged to support individuals living with lupus, a chronic autoimmune disease which affects thousands of Jamaicans. This urging comes from Lupus Foundation of Jamaica (LFJ) President, and Rheumatologist, Dr. Désirée Tulloch-Reid.
